Marketing News   -   Mar 14, 2018 Bug affecting Doubleclick (DFP, DCM and DBM) cause ad impressions not being tracked or recorded

Yesterday, according to the Ads Status Dashboard, Google faced a bug on the buying side and seller side of programmatic, affecting DCM (Doubleclick Campaign Manager), DBM (Doubleclick Bid Manager), DFP (Doubleclick For Publishers) and DS (Doubleclick Search). The bug in Doubleclick was solved on the same day - March 13
